Zokora: we´ll be better next yr

Tottenham mdifielder Didier Zokora believes that Spurs will be a force to be reckoned with next season as Juande Ramos begins his first full season.

  • "Modric's arrival is great news for fans, as it shows we mean business," said Zokora.



    "This is a club that has the fan base and the money to try to get into the top four Champions League places next season - and we will do it. I'm convinced we can and will do it.



    "I watch my Ivory Coast friends Didier Drogba and Salomon Kalou playing for Chelsea in the Champions League and just wish it was me.



    "I only want the best. That is what all the players at Spurs want and, under Ramos, we can do it - we can become a top-four club. Why not?"
